Taking basic health care coverage away from kids is never in the state's long-term interests. But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ger pushed through a new set of Medi-Cal requirements that did just that last year in an effort to save the state $25 million in 2009 and perhaps as much as $90 million in 2010.
Now that bonehead move could prevent California from capturing at least $10 billion and perhaps as much as $14 billion - yes, that's a "B" - in federal stimulus money unless the state changes its eligibility rules by July 1.
